Перейти к содержанию
    

SED1335,PIC18F4550 и LCD320x240

Добрый день !

А можно в место XC9572 использовать XC9536

Да-да и мне хотелось бы знать,просто есть возможность достать нахаляву...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Добрый день !

А можно в место XC9572 использовать XC9536

если вся запрограмированная требуха в неё влезет, и если перерисовать плату,не знаю сколько там у неё ног, если столько же,то не надо, то можно..

Проверил компиляцию содержимого ПЛИСки

Summary

Design Name Scop

Fitting Status Successful

Software Version K.31

Device Used XC9536-7-PC44

Date 3-27-2009, 4:26PM

 

 

RESOURCES SUMMARY

Macrocells Used Pterms Used Registers Used Pins Used Function Block Inputs Used

34/36 (95%) 85/180 (48%) 25/36 (70%) 31/34 (92%) 55/72 (77%)

Короче всё влезло, проект откомпилировался без ошибок.Только уже надо по-новой распиновку внутри XC9536 делать

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а в альтеровскую плиску можно ?

На рынке без проблем у меня в городе можно купить EPM3064ALC44-10N

или есть особенности?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а в альтеровскую плиску можно ?

На рынке без проблем у меня в городе можно купить EPM3064ALC44-10N

или есть особенности?

а вы умеете это делать?, если да, то тогда но проблемо.Содержимое ПЛИСки в растровом виде я кажется тут выкладывал

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

а вы умеете это делать?, если да, то тогда но проблемо.Содержимое ПЛИСки в растровом виде я кажется тут выкладывал

Пока не умею но ваша тема разожгла огромное желание научится.

А учится никогда не поздно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пока не умею но ваша тема разожгла огромное желание научится.

А учится никогда не поздно.

ну тогда вперёд и с песней..... нам песня строить и жить помогаааает....ну дальше вы знаете :beer: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Очень хочу собрать этот прибор. Давно ничего путнего не собирал, кроме кучки программаторов и мелких приборов, в основном ремонтами вынужден заниматься. И огромная проблемма это печатная плата. Если есть у кого лишняя плата, свяжитесь пожалуйста со мной ( [email protected]). Очень буду признателен.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Очень хочу собрать этот прибор. Давно ничего путнего не собирал, кроме кучки программаторов и мелких приборов, в основном ремонтами вынужден заниматься. И огромная проблемма это печатная плата. Если есть у кого лишняя плата, свяжитесь пожалуйста со мной ( [email protected]). Очень буду признателен.
могу предложить готовый за рубли....

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Огромное спасибо, но мне бы платку, остальное хочу сваять сам. Вы, творческий человек, у меня на это нет времени.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Заказал две платы,одну себе а другую мож кому надо имейте ввиду,стоит 550р+ пересылка.

Павел, может поделитесь, если есть возможность. :rolleyes:

Изменено пользователем Gydwin

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Все спаял.Испытания показали:чтото рисует,но не то что надо.Из кнопок sec_div работают только три,остальные не работают вобще.ПЛИс греется,где то я про это читал.Прошивки из сообщения 206.монтаж проверил перепроверил,все впорядке.Может в архиве лежат бета прошивки.Помогите,ни знаю где искать?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Все спаял.Испытания показали:чтото рисует,но не то что надо.Из кнопок sec_div работают только три,остальные не работают вобще.ПЛИс греется,где то я про это читал.Прошивки из сообщения 206.монтаж проверил перепроверил,все впорядке.Может в архиве лежат бета прошивки.Помогите,ни знаю где искать?

Повторяю ещё раз, никаких изменений с последнего выкладывания в ответе 206 лично я не делал, у меня всё работает. ПЛИСка да, греется, не знаю почему,всё таки там 80 Мгц, ещё раз проверяйте схему, правильность распиновки портов,особенно ПЛИСки,КЗ ищите и всё такое.... возможно где-то дорожка перетравилась, лично я не доверяю никаким ЛУТ-методам...

тут последняя прошивка для ПИКа, щас упакую прошивку для ПЛИСки и тоже выложу, хотя там тоже самое

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пожалуйста обьясните какие функции выполняет ПЛИС в этой схеме, тактирует ФИФО?

... память там стоит на 512 байт, а здесь на 8Кбайт.......

Прежде всего хочется сказать спасибо автору за проделанный труд. В частности меня он тоже сподвиг на решение похожей задачи.

Теперь несколько слов по сути проскакивающих здесь вопросов.

Вряд ли стоит пытаться создать прибор с похожими характеристиками, не используя ПЛИС. Никакой процессор, включая АРМ7 (о PIC вообще не стоит говорить), не способен тактировать входной АЦП и складывать в свой буфер поступающий поток данных. Используя только процессор, можно создать только низкочастотный осциллограф. Так как нас интересует скоростной прибор, то мы должны использовать быстродействующий АЦП и тактировать его с большой скоростью. Надо четко понимать циклограмму функционирования такого прибора. Данный прибор представляет из себя "конечный автомат", обладающий несколькими состояниями. Рассмотрим их.

1 состояние - Плиска тактирует АЦП и складывает данные во внешний или внутренний FIFO. Плиски с подходящим внутренним ОЗУ имеются. Примером может служить серия Cyclone от Altera. Аналогичные есть и у XILINX. Размер FIFO должен быть сопряжен с количеством точек на LCD по горизонтали. Как показывает опыт Тектроникса 8 разрядов в АЦП достаточно для приемлимого качества наблюдаемой картинки. Для обеспечения программной синхронизации размер буфера должен быть в 1.5 - 2 раза больше, т.е. 512 байт вполне достаточно для экрана с разрешением 320 x 240. Для двухканального варианта надо использовать 2 буфера.

2 состояние - Процессор вычитывает содержимого FIFO в свою память. Скорость вычитывания - определяется возможностями процессора и может быть существенно ниже скорости записи в FIFO буфер.

3 состояние - Процессор анализирует содержимое буфера, находя точку синхронизации.

4 состояние - Процессор обновляет осциллограмму на экране.

Далее переход к первому состоянию.

Конечно - это упрощенный алгоритм. Здесь не показан момент взаимодействия с органами управления, не описаны процедуры начальной инициализации и т.д. Но в целом - это так и работает.

Вопрос об относительно низкой скорости вывода осциллограммы на экран на самом деле не так уж и актуален. Достаточно вспомнить как работает осциллограф в режиме однократной развертки. Мы же используем его достаточно часто.

В общем задача не такая уж и сложная, как кажется на первый взгляд. Надо просто браться и делать!!!

Так что всем желаю удачи в творческом процессе.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Имею проблемы с приобретением ads831e.

 

А чем ее можно заменить, без ухудшения параметров?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Гость
Эта тема закрыта для публикации ответов.
×
×
  • Создать...